Modern Kitchen Islands for Every Home

A kitchen island can revamp your cooking space, providing extra counter surface and a focal point for family. Whether you prefer a minimalist aesthetic or something vibrant, there's a kitchen island style to suit your design's vibe.

  • Consider materials like durable quartz, sleek stainless steel, or natural wood to create a piece that is both functional and appealing.
  • Add cabinets for utensils and ingredients to keep your kitchen clutter-free.
  • Look into features like built-in basin, a wine cooler, or even a bar area to optimize your island's space.

Through these tips, you can find the perfect stylish kitchen island to enhance your cooking and entertaining space.

Create a Focal Point: Ideas for Your Dream Kitchen Island

Your kitchen island is more than just a surface—it's the soul of your culinary kingdom. To truly make it shine, consider incorporating elements that enhance its presence and function. A stylish countertop in a contrasting color or pattern can add a pop of visual interest.Integrate seating at the perimeter for casual meals or gatherings, turning your island into a social hub. Explore unique lighting fixtures to highlight its architectural design, creating a warm and inviting ambiance.

  • Boost storage space with built-in drawers, shelves, or cabinets, keeping your kitchen organized and clutter-free.
  • Venture with different materials for the island top, such as granite, marble, butcher block, or even reclaimed wood, to complement your personal style.
  • Incorporate a sink into your island design to create a functional workspace and add an element of sophistication.
